HEALTHY HAIR TIPS & ADVICE
- The winter months can be hard on your hair. The air is very drying so it is imperative that you keep your hair moisturized. Use plenty of conditioning treatments and even throw in a hot oil treatment every couple of weeks. Also be sure to wear satin or silk lined winter hats and scarves. The cotton/wool from those warm winter hats can be very damaging. To read more on the importance of moisture visit the information site:

- Your ends should be trimmed approximately every 6-8 weeks. Getting this done on a regular schedule promotes hair growth and a better looking head of hair. Some people fear that they are "cutting off their length" , but the fact of the matter is its not "length" when its dried out and jagged. Excessive heat styling can cause a need for you to trim more often, so put down those flat irons and curling wands! - Maintaining healthy hair consist of doing 3 main things: Condition, Trim & Moisturize. Regardless of hair hair texture, we all need conditioner. For those with fine hair, ask your stylist or sales person to recommend conditioner in a light spray form. Curly/Coarse hair needs a heavier, cream style conditioner. Having the proper moisture is in your hair, on a daily basis is also needed to prevent splitting and drying out. These things can happen due to environment, styling aids and other situations. - To keep your color from fading, shampoo your hair with shampoo designed for color-treated hair. Reds fade the fastest, so don't be alarmed. Be sure to use cooler water to ensure long lasting color and you will also get a great shine in the process! www.TheHair411.blogspot.com
